Butler Middle School, located in Waukesha, Wisconsin, serves grades 6-8 in the Waukesha School District. It has received a GreatSchools Rating of 5 out of 10, based on its performance on state standardized tests.
The school community has reviewed this school and given it an average rating of 4 out of 5 stars.

My oldest son attended Butler, the experience was very positive. We had a number of challenges to overcome in 8th grade, injuries and a death in our family, The school was very compassionate, the guidance staff always available and helpful. The principal is a very kind and understanding to our special needs. The school worked with unusual circumstances and understands that we don't always have to fit the mold. The teachers were positive, the school is safe. The school always worked for best outcome for the student. Very positive experience.
